February Spotlight :  Welding Student – Erin Quick

 

Erin Quick has always known she wanted to be a welder—the first in her family to do so. Life had other plans for a while, and like many adults, Erin put her dream on hold while she focused on work and responsibilities. After six years as a server, she realized she wanted more than a job—she wanted a career.

 

This year, Erin decided it was time. She researched welding programs that would truly fit her life and goals, and that search led her to PLCC. Evening classes, Fridays off, hands-on learning, and strong recommendations made all the difference. Erin says the instructors, learning environment, and real-world experience have been everything she hoped for—and more. She even calls PLCC the “Ivy League of trade schools.”

 

For Erin, learning from a book matters—but learning by doing is what keeps her motivated and coming back every day. So much so that she’s encouraged friends and family to follow their own paths at PLCC, too.

 

Erin often reflects on a quote from Jim Carrey: “You can fail at what you don’t want, so you might as well take a chance at doing what you love.”

 

She’s doing just that—and her future in welding is getting closer every day.
